What drug use disqualifies you from being a police officer?
Use of drugs like heroin, cocaine, or crystal meth often result in disqualification, unless the drug use happened in the distant past and you've been clean since. As for marijuana, it's complicated. Although many states have legalized marijuana use, it is still illegal federally.

How long does it take to become a cop in Michigan?
Attend a basic training academy After you've completed both exams, you can start an MCOLES-accredited police academy program. Many colleges, universities and training academies throughout the state offer these programs, which are a minimum of 594 hours long or 14 weeks.

What is generally a disqualifying factor for employment as a police officer?
Felony or domestic violence conviction: if you have one of these, you can't lawfully possess a firearm. No firearm, no cop. Moral turpitude conviction: crimes of theft, of deception or fraud, or that otherwise demonstrate poor moral character are disqualifying.

What are the requirements to be a police officer in Michigan?
Requirements to become a police officer in Michigan Be at least 18 years of age. Be a citizen of the United States. Have a valid driver's license. Have a high school diploma or GED. Have no history of disqualifying criminal offenses. Have good moral character and integrity. Have satisfactory hearing without aids.

What disqualifies you from being a cop in Michigan?
Disqualifying offenses include adjudications of guilt for a violation or attempted violation of a penal law of this state or another jurisdiction that is punishable by imprisonment for more than 1 year (includes all felonies).

What is the MCOLES Outstanding Performance Award?
The MCOLES award is presented to one graduate per police academy, who exhibits exemplary demonstration of knowledge, skills, and abilities, required of an effective police officer during the basic training program.

How long is the police academy in Michigan?
All new police officer candidates must attend a certified police academy in the State of Michigan. MCOLES requires 594 hours of training (14 weeks).
